
Recorded in a remote village in their homeland, "Amadjar" captures Tinariwen in a raw, stripped-down setting, emphasizing the hypnotic qualities of their guitar work and vocalizations. The album stands as a testament to their enduring artistic vision and deep connection to their roots.
- "Amadjar" was recorded in a period of just five days in the home of a band member in Mourdjah, near Tessalit, Mali.
- The album features guest appearances from Eyadou Ag Leche and Terakaft's Diarha, adding further depth to Tinariwen's signature sound.
- "Amadjar" was released on the Wedge Records label, known for its commitment to world and folk music genres.
Tinariwen is a Tuareg band from the Sahara Desert, known for their distinctive "desert blues" sound. Their music blends traditional Tuareg rhythms with rock and folk influences, creating a unique and powerful sonic landscape.
